Transaction eac34d7ecb7b2accc86685d63c4d30ecfd95fb929efcfab021f1b61dc5bdd1d3
2 Input
2 Outputs
- eac34d7ecb7b2accc86685d63c4d30ecfd95fb929efcfab021f1b61dc5bdd1d3:0
- eac34d7ecb7b2accc86685d63c4d30ecfd95fb929efcfab021f1b61dc5bdd1d3:1
value 1079928000
address 15QHFNnzuf8h9KZHF1V3QCSCzzzn1d1nYK
value 20399033698
address 3NhGr12dQXdGC8EThBfXrwuRdoZmSFLQTa